What version of the plugin are you using? That was a symptom of the previous version. Make sure you are using the latest. Also, if you read the last 20 posts, the developer is about to push a major update. It will fix a host of issues, however, the problem you're describing has already been fixed in the newest version. I'm using it.
Notifier [Unmaintained]
Discussion in 'Plugin Support' started by NobodyFTW, Feb 1, 2015.
-
ideal thanks for your time
-
plug-in is unable to determine from which country users to connect.
Always write unknown -
Just wasnt
-
And for that I thank you. -
Exception raised in web request callback (KeyNotFoundException: The given key was not present in the dictionary.)
not correct the error? -
I'm getting this on joins:
Code:[Oxide] 7:22 AM [Info] [Notifier v2.9.2] :: Jayce joined the server, from Australia. [Oxide] 7:22 AM [Error] Exception raised in web request callback (KeyNotFoundException: The given key was not present in the dictionary.) [Oxide] 7:22 AM [Debug] at System.Collections.Generic.Dictionary`2<object, object>.get_Item (object) <0x001c5> at IronPython.Runtime.NewStringFormatter/Formatter.GetUnaccessedObject (IronPython.Runtime.NewStringFormatter/FieldName) <0x000e2> at IronPython.Runtime.NewStringFormatter/Formatter.GetArgumentValue (IronPython.Runtime.NewStringFormatter/FieldName) <0x00031> at IronPython.Runtime.NewStringFormatter/Formatter.ReplaceText (string) <0x003d4> at IronPython.Runtime.NewStringFormatter/Formatter.FormatString (IronPython.Runtime.PythonContext,string,IronPython.Runtime.PythonTuple,System.Collections.Generic.IDictionary`2<object, object>) <0x00072> at IronPython.Runtime.NewStringFormatter.FormatString (IronPython.Runtime.PythonContext,string,IronPython.Runtime.PythonTuple,System.Collections.Generic.IDictionary`2<object, object>) <0x000a3> at IronPython.Runtime.Operations.StringOps.format (IronPython.Runtime.CodeContext,string,System.Collections.Generic.IDictionary`2<object, object>,object[]) <0x00067> at (wrapper dynamic-method) object.CallSite.Target (System.Runtime.CompilerServices.Closure,System.Runtime.CompilerServices.CallSite,IronPython.Runtime.CodeContext,object,object,object,object,object) <0x00390> at (wrapper dynamic-method) object.response_handler$45 (System.Runtime.CompilerServices.Closure,IronPython.Runtime.PythonFunction,object,object) <0x02791>
Last edited by a moderator: Jul 7, 2015 -
NEW VERSION IS ALMOST READY!
Guys, v2.10.0 is pretty much ready, I have a few people testing it out on their servers to help me out finding any bugs or sort of stuff that needs a final tweak before I make it an official release and finally get rid of all the mess from last week. I promised you I would give me my all on this new version to compensate all that, and believe me I am. There's bunch of new stuff and improvements to pretty much everything.
You can help out testing it out if you want by just downloading the attached file.
IMPORTANT NOTES:
- This version requires a full configuration reset, any configuration files older than this version's will be replaced with the new default file, and this will also apply on the official release even if you don't use this.
- If you use the attached file to help testing it, your config file WILL NOT reset on the official release.
If anyone tests this, please give me any feedback as soon as possible so I can release it as soon as I find it stable. And for you I thank you in advance for helping.Attached Files:
-
-
Got this in version 2.10:
Code:[Oxide] 3:58 PM [Error] Failed to run a 360.00 timer in notifier (KeyNotFoundException: The given key was not present in the dictionary.) [Oxide] 3:58 PM [Debug] at System.Collections.Generic.Dictionary`2[System.Object,System.Object].get_Item (System.Object key) [0x00000] in <filename unknown>:0 at IronPython.Runtime.NewStringFormatter+Formatter.GetUnaccessedObject (FieldName fieldName) [0x00000] in <filename unknown>:0 at IronPython.Runtime.NewStringFormatter+Formatter.GetArgumentValue (FieldName fieldName) [0x00000] in <filename unknown>:0 at IronPython.Runtime.NewStringFormatter+Formatter.ReplaceText (System.String format) [0x00000] in <filename unknown>:0 at IronPython.Runtime.NewStringFormatter+Formatter.FormatString (IronPython.Runtime.PythonContext context, System.String format, IronPython.Runtime.PythonTuple args, IDictionary`2 kwArgs) [0x00000] in <filename unknown>:0 at IronPython.Runtime.NewStringFormatter.FormatString (IronPython.Runtime.PythonContext context, System.String format, IronPython.Runtime.PythonTuple args, IDictionary`2 kwArgs) [0x00000] in <filename unknown>:0 at IronPython.Runtime.Operations.StringOps.format (IronPython.Runtime.CodeContext context, System.String format_string, IDictionary`2 kwargs, System.Object[] args) [0x00000] in <filename unknown>:0 at Microsoft.Scripting.Interpreter.FuncCallInstruction`5[IronPython.Runtime.CodeContext,System.String,System.Collections.Generic.IDictionary`2[System.Object,System.Object],System.Object[],System.String].Run (Microsoft.Scripting.Interpreter.InterpretedFrame frame) [0x00000] in <filename unknown>:0 at Microsoft.Scripting.Interpreter.Interpreter.Run (Microsoft.Scripting.Interpreter.InterpretedFrame frame) [0x00000] in <filename unknown>:0
Last edited by a moderator: Jul 7, 2015 -
bonjour depuis la dernière maj non prob du plug-in et survenu au niveau du message de bienvenue qui apparaît plus quand le joueur se connecte , es que le problème a déjà été signaler où ces que moi , je tiens à préciser aussi que le plugin a été désinstaller entièrement et reinstaler mais rien je ne vois pas dout vient le prob merci à vous .
-
SkinN,
Haven't been able to get the "IP" to work in the /map link. It will show the port, but not the IP address.
Also, in the ADVERT section: "<red>Cheat is strictly prohibited.<end>", should be "Cheating"
else? looking good -
SkinN, all working fine, but pleas, add an option to disable list of player's names (names only, not quantity!) I don't want that my players knew who exactly online! Many thanks for your work!
-
no, it isn't required in my config. i'll add it and try though. thanks
-
Code:"ENABLE JOIN MESSAGE": true,
-
-
any way we can keep this English for others to learn/follow along?
-
hi, deleted the notifier.py, notifier.json, and the notifier_countries_db.json. Installed the notifier,py file. For some reason I still do not see the countries players join from. I attached a SS of the welcome message. Thanks for all your hard work and time you spend making, fixing, and updating your plugins.
Attached Files:
-
-
@Joplin I believe it's only for when other people join. Not when you join. You already know where you are right?
-
oh ok, It used to say my country when I joined also